  23. scuzzy

    Parallel and Series wiring on Area J. Not really hearing it!

    Most of the time Series will have much more mid range punch, and be louder. You will loses some top end and a bit of low bass.

  37. scuzzy

    Getting hum on a split pickup

    that's a text book shielding issue. present in some environments, absent in others. the good news, it's a simple fix. our church has a massive light dimmer panel behind stage, it can smell out a poorly shielded instrument in the most humbling way.
